Abstract

Ceiling values for each of the eight main pollutants responsible for air pollution in the UK have been established as part of the Government's National Air Quality Strategy. The strategy tackles the three main sources of the pollutants, vehicle fumes, energy generation and industrial processes. Cleaner fuels and cleaner exhaust systems will help reduce pollution from vehicle fumes but a range of more environmentally sustainable travel choices is needed to discourage car use. Pollution from energy generation is being tackled under the European Union Acidification Strategy.
